自定义模块之间的Sugarcrm关系

时间:2014-04-17 13:51:36

标签: php mysql sugarcrm

我是使用Sugar crm的新手,我正在使用带有MySQL和IIS7窗口的Sugar CE 6.5.16。 我创建了两个模块,部署它们,添加自定义字段和布局。 evrything工作正常。为了获得主模块的详细视图,子模块列出了第二个模块中与之相关的项目.i在这两个模块之间建立了一对多的关系。问题是当点击主要模块元素时没有显示任何内容(没有详细视图或其他任何内容),辅助模块确实显示了一个新项目以将项目与其关联,并且详细信息视图很好。 evrything是通过工作室和模块构建器完成的。没有进行文件编辑。 我认为问题出在这个文件中:\ custom \ modules \ Primary_module \ Ext \ layoutdefs \ layoutdefs.exe.php:

<?php 
//WARNING: The contents of this file are auto-generated
// created: 2014-04-17 15:19:10
$layout_defs["plt01_Chassis"]["subpanel_setup"]['plt01_chassis_plt01_cartes_1'] =array   (
'order' => 100,
'module' => 'plt01_Cartes',
'subpanel_name' => 'default',
'sort_order' => 'asc',
'sort_by' => 'id',
'title_key' => 'LBL_PLT01_CHASSIS_PLT01_CARTES_1_FROM_PLT01_CARTES_TITLE',
'get_subpanel_data' => 'plt01_chassis_plt01_cartes_1',
'top_buttons' => 
array (
0 => 
array (
  'widget_class' => 'SubPanelTopButtonQuickCreate',
),
1 => 
array (
  'widget_class' => 'SubPanelTopSelectButton',
  'mode' => 'MultiSelect',
),
),
);
//auto-generated file DO NOT EDIT
$layout_defs['plt01_Chassis']['subpanel_setup']['plt01_chassis_plt01_cartes_1']['override_subpanel_name'] = 'plt01_Chassis_subpanel_plt01_chassis_plt01_cartes_1';
?>

因为当我删除内容时会显示详细视图但没有子面板......请帮忙吗?

1 个答案:

答案 0 :(得分:0)

得到它固定的人..问题是法语语言包...我使用英语登录和自定义模块关系工作,详细视图出现在子面板!! 如果有人有同样的问题...尝试这个,看看它是否有效。 最诚挚的问候